Acer: Windows 7 helped PC sales
|  |
Posted on Monday, November 30 2009 @ 01:25:23 CET by Thomas De Maesschalck |
Acer CEO Gianfranco Lanci revealed Windows 7 provided a small but noticeable boost in PC sales:
He said the increase in sales was not so much because Windows 7 was a better operating system, but because of the natural cycle to replace or upgrade old hardware. Dell has also reported a slight lift to its own sales but hasn’t said if it expects more more sales.
Corporate buyers, which are Dell's biggest customers are still not too sure about Windows 7 and are waiting for a more mature product. They want to see how Windows 7 behaves on different hardware.
